Professor Kakkar joined Barts and The London in July 2004 and leads Professor Kakkar (HEFCE-funded) leads the only multidisciplinary research programme in the area of cancer-associated thrombosis in the UK.Venous thromboembolic disease (VTE) remains the commonest avoidable cause of hospital death in the UK, and is estimated to affect the natural history of up to 20% of cancer patients with fatal pulmonary embolism - the second commonest cause of death in cancer patients.Professor Kakkar, who is also Director of the Thrombosis Research Institute in London, is internationally recognised in this area, having led the landmark studies of the use of low molecular weight heparin in prevention and treatment of cancer-associated thrombosis (FAMOUS, CLOT in Cancer, MC-4).These not only appeared in high-profile journals but formed the basis of international practice guidelines (American College of Chest Physicians and ASCO).He is now principal investigator and steering group member for large clinical trials of novel agents targeting factors Xa and IIa in cancer populations for both thrombosis prevention and cancer survival studies.

Professor Ajay Kakkar
As well as Director Designate of the Thrombosis Research Institute, London, Ajay Kakkar is Professor and Head of the Centre for Surgical Sciences and Dean for External Relations at Barts and the London School of Medicine and Dentistry, Queen Mary, University of London.He is also a Consultant Surgeon at St Bartholomew's Hospital in London.He received his medical education at King's College Hospital Medical School, University of London, and was awarded an MBBS in 1988 and a PhD in 1998.He was made a fellow of the Royal College of Surgeons of England in 1992.
His awards include Hunterian Professor, Royal College of Surgeons of England 1996, the David Patey Prize, Surgical Research Society of Great Britain and Ireland 1996, the Knoll William Harvey Prize, International Society on Thrombosis and Haemostasis 1997 and the James IV Association of Surgeons Fellow 2006.
Professor Kakkar's research interests are in the prevention and treatment of venous thromboembolic disease and cancer-associated thrombosis and, in particular, the role of antithrombotic therapy in prolonging survival in cancer and the role of coagulation serine proteases in tumour biology.
